The BFSI sector is one of the largest adopters of Partner Relationship Management (PRM) solutions, given the industry’s reliance on channel partnerships to extend their services and products to a broader customer base. Banks, insurance companies, and other financial institutions frequently collaborate with agents, brokers, and other intermediaries to distribute their products. PRM solutions in the BFSI industry help manage these relationships effectively by providing a centralized platform for communication, data sharing, and performance tracking. This improves the overall service quality and ensures that financial partners are aligned with the institution's goals and compliance standards. Furthermore, PRM systems enable more efficient partner onboarding processes, seamless integration of partner systems, and customized reporting features that support data-driven decision-making.Additionally, the BFSI industry faces the challenge of managing compliance and regulatory requirements, which is often more complex due to the multiplicity of partners involved. PRM solutions offer robust compliance management features, helping organizations to monitor and manage partner adherence to industry regulations. With the growing trend of digital banking and online financial services, PRM solutions also play a critical role in ensuring that partnerships within the digital ecosystem are well-structured and managed. By leveraging PRM technology, BFSI companies can better assess partner performance, drive revenue, and improve their overall customer experience through efficient collaboration with partners.
The IT and telecommunications sector heavily relies on third-party partners to manage and expand their service offerings. Partner Relationship Management (PRM) solutions in this industry are designed to handle large, complex partner ecosystems, where managing relationships with resellers, value-added distributors, technology vendors, and service providers is a key business strategy. PRM tools help organizations manage sales incentives, co-branded marketing campaigns, partner performance metrics, and product distribution across multiple partner tiers. As a result, these solutions enable IT and telecom companies to streamline communication, monitor partner performance in real-time, and optimize the distribution process to meet customer demands more effectively.In addition to enhancing operational efficiency, PRM solutions within the IT and telecommunication industries also support innovation and business transformation. With the increasing integration of new technologies, such as 5G, cloud computing, and AI, PRM systems help partners stay aligned with the fast-evolving industry landscape. They also play a critical role in enabling the development of joint go-to-market strategies and enhancing training and certification programs for partners. In a market where the rapid pace of change is a constant, PRM solutions allow companies to effectively manage and scale partnerships that are crucial for competitive advantage and market expansion.

The Partner Relationship Management (PRM) solution market is evolving rapidly, driven by several key trends and emerging opportunities that businesses across various industries can leverage. One of the major trends is the increasing adoption of cloud-based PRM solutions, which offer flexibility, scalability, and lower upfront costs compared to traditional on-premise systems. Cloud PRM solutions also enable real-time data sharing, better collaboration, and integration with other enterprise systems, creating a more streamlined partner management process. Additionally, the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) within PRM systems is providing businesses with advanced analytics capabilities, helping them to make more informed decisions about partner performance, opportunities, and market trends.Another significant trend is the growing focus on providing a personalized partner experience. As businesses aim to create more meaningful, long-term relationships with their partners, PRM systems are becoming increasingly tailored to the specific needs of individual partners. Features such as personalized training programs, customized dashboards, and targeted marketing campaigns are helping organizations build stronger relationships with partners and drive higher levels of engagement. Furthermore, the rise of digital transformation is creating opportunities for PRM solutions to integrate with other business systems, such as Customer Relationship Management (CRM) and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) platforms, offering more comprehensive partner ecosystem management solutions. What is a Partner Relationship Management (PRM) solution?
A PRM solution helps businesses manage and optimize their relationships with external partners, such as suppliers, distributors, and resellers, through improved communication, collaboration, and performance tracking.
How does a PRM system benefit businesses?
PRM systems help businesses streamline partner management, improve performance, automate workflows, and drive revenue by optimizing partner interactions and collaboration.
What industries benefit from PRM solutions?
Industries such as BFSI, IT & Telecommunications, healthcare, retail, manufacturing, and energy are among the key sectors that benefit from PRM solutions to manage complex partner ecosystems.
What are the key features of a PRM system?
Key features of PRM systems include partner onboarding, performance tracking, co-marketing tools, training and certification, sales incentives, and data analytics.
What is the difference between CRM and PRM systems?
While CRM systems focus on managing customer relationships, PRM systems are designed to manage relationships with external partners, including suppliers, distributors, and resellers.
How can PRM systems help with compliance management?
PRM solutions provide tools to ensure that partners adhere to industry regulations, compliance standards, and contractual obligations, minimizing the risk of non-compliance.
What is the role of AI in PRM systems?
AI can enhance PRM systems by providing predictive analytics, helping businesses forecast partner performance and identify potential growth opportunities.
Can PRM systems be integrated with other enterprise software?
Yes, PRM systems can often be integrated with other software like CRM, ERP, and marketing automation tools to provide a more holistic view of partner performance and collaboration.
What is the future of PRM solutions?
The future of PRM solutions includes further adoption of AI, cloud technologies, and personalized partner experiences, as well as broader integration with enterprise systems for end-to-end partner ecosystem management.
How do PRM solutions support sales and marketing efforts?
PRM systems help optimize sales and marketing efforts by offering tools for joint campaigns, co-branded marketing materials, sales incentives, and performance tracking.
